Harnessing the cGAS-STING pathway to potentiate radiation therapy: current approaches and future directions

In this review, we cover the current understanding of how radiation therapy, which uses ionizing radiation to kill cancer cells, mediates an anti-tumor immune response through the cGAS-STING pathway, and how STING agonists might potentiate this.
